Etymology[edit]
From Russian ме́дник (médnik, “coppersmith”), a Jewish Ashkenazi occupational surname.

Statistics[edit]
- According to the 2010 United States Census, Mednick is the 38389th most common surname in the United States, belonging to 577 individuals. Mednick is most common among White (95.49%) individuals.
